E-Textiles Network Webinar – E-Textiles for Wearable Healthcare


Presented by Dr Kai Yang, University of Southampton

E-textiles are advanced textiles that include electronic functionality ranging from conductive tracks to sensing/actuating, and communications. Emerging advanced e-textiles offer great opportunities to push the boundaries of technologies used in healthcare by improving the user experience (e.g. comfortable to wear, easy to use) and motivating the user adherence. This talk covers market opportunities, e-textile technologies overview, case studies, and opportunities/challenges for the research and commercialisation of e-textile based wearable medical devices.
